Founded by Od-de, the elder brother of Lha Lama Changchub Od, in the 11th century, this monastery is the home of the Tsonkhapa order of Tibetan Buddhism. It is famous for the giant statue it has of the Goddess Kali. The structure rises on a hill overlooking the Indus river, making for some great views. Getting around the complex involves climbing between terraced landings. Make sure to visit the Mahakaal Temple. The main hall has sculptures, chortens, and masks of deities. It also has a statue that purportedly contains the remains of Tsongkhapa’s nose-bleed. The Gustor Festival is held at the monastery from the 27th to 29th day of the 11th month of the Tibetan Calendar.

Nearby is the tantrik Vajra Bhairav Shrine. Open only once annually, the Shrine is supposed to have a potent effect on whoever steps inside. Its walls are covered with 600 year old paintings depicting the myths associated to the shrine. It has a collection of weapons and fierce looking deities. The shrine is on a cliff top, and quite exotic to Ladakh’s usual fare.
